FOUNDATION.

32

1.

Saint Paul's College at Victoria is primarily founded for

the object of training a body of Native Clergy and Christian

Teachers for the propagation of the Gospel in China according

to the principales of the United Church of England and Ireland

and under the immediate control of the Bishop of the said

Diocese.

It shall however be lawful to admit to the benefits

of the College such Students European as well as Native as

being educated in conformity with the doctrine and discipline

of the Church of England shall afford in the judgment of the

Bishop the hope of their diffusing through their example and

influence the blessings of Christianity and civilization.

2.

THE COLLEGE PROPERTY.

All sums of money and books already given, and property

of every kind hereafter to be given transferred or bequeathed

to the purposes of the College shall be vested for the benefit

of the said College in the Bishop of Victoria for the time

being as constituted by Her Majesty's Letters Patent a Body

Corporate.

3.

THE GOVERNMENT OF THE COLLEGE.

The government and entire control of the College is

vested in the Bishop of Victoria as ex officio Warden; except

so far as any jurisdiction or authority may by him be dele-

gated to a Sub-Warden or others. Upon questions of grave

importance a reference may nevertheless be made to the Arch-

bishop of Canterbury whose decision shall be final and to whom

also the Warden shall forward Annual Reports of the progress

of the College.
